With reference to the expenditure made by an organization or a company, which of the following statements is/are correct? (UPSC Prelims, 2022)1. Acquiring new technology is a capital expenditure.2. Debt financing is considered capital expenditure, while equity financing is considered revenue expenditure.Select the correct answer using the code given below:
✓ Correct answer: a) 1 only
ExplanationAns: A Exp:Statement 1 is correct: When a company funds are used to acquire, upgrade, and maintain physical assets such as property, plants, buildings, technology, or equipment are known as Capital Expenditure (CapEx) of a Company.When a company borrows money to be paid back at a future date with interest it is known as debt financing.Example: Repayment of a loan is an example of capital expenditure.Statement 2 is incorrect: Equity financing is the process of raising capital through the sale of shares.It is an example of non-debt capital receipts.Capital receipts are receipts that create liabilities or reduce financial assets.They also refer to incoming cash flows.Examples: Recovery of loans and advances, disinvestment, issue of bonus shares, etc.
